#b53cec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b53cec is composed of 71% red, 23.5%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.3% cyan, 74.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 281.3 degrees, a saturation of 82.2% and a lightness of 58%. #b53cec color hex could be obtained by blending #ff78ff with #6b00d9.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

#b53cec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b53cec has RGB values of R:181, G:60, B:236 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 11877612.
